WWE’s new registration schedule – post-multiple positive test results – has been revealed.

POST Wrestling reports that WWE has concluded the recording of this week’s Monday Night Raw episode today and that the next series of broadcasts will now be recorded between July 1 and July 3.

On July 1, the company will record NXT shows that will air on July 1 and 8, these are the two Great American Bash specials.

July 2 is devoted to the recording of SmackDown programs from July 3 and July 10 as well as 205 Live, which are broadcast immediately after the Friday evening program.

Finally, July 3 is Monday evening on Raw, with the July 6 and July 13 broadcasts recorded with the Main Event and the Raw Raw post-talk talk show.

It was also noted that the previously scheduled Thursday NXT recordings will no longer take place that day next week.

Renee Young, Kayla Braxton and Adam Pearce are among the WWE names who confirmed their positive test at the time. It now seems that WWE is trying to reduce the risk with these intense recordings – compared to the introduction of talent into the PC every week – and the introduction of masks for those who act as fans at the edge of the ring.
